Fragment of a frieze from the church of San Martino ai Monti, Rome, Italy, (1928). 'About 850...time of Leo IV. (847-855). The bird frieze was carried under the roof of the basilica. Its value is in its rareness; it is the only one in Rome of which a fragment is preserved'. After Joseph Wilpert. Plate XLIX, fig 108, from "An Encyclopaedia of Colour Decoration from the Earliest Times to the Middle of the XIXth Century" with explanatory text by Helmuth Bossert. [Ernst Wasmuth Ltd., Berlin, 1928]. Creator Unknown. (Photo by The Print Collector/Heritage Images via Getty Images)
